分享web开发知识

注册/登录|最近发布|今日推荐

主页 IT知识网页技术软件开发前端开发代码编程运营维护技术分享教程案例
当前位置:首页 > 技术分享

慕课 jQuery ?2018/6/21

发布时间:2023-09-06 02:00责任编辑:顾先生关键词:jQuery

Jquery 文档:api.jquery.com

Dom对象和Jquery对象

if(obj.nodeType) ?//检测DOM Object ??return 1if(obj.jquery) ???????//检测jQuery object ??ruturn jquery version 1.12.4转换var jqueryObj=$(domObj); ??//$() 包裹var domObj=jqueryObj.get([index]); ??//get方法
创建一个html元素:
var div=$("<div>hello</div>"); ?//创建一个$()包裹的html.console.log(div); ???//输出dom ?divconsole.log($("div")); ?//jquery 选择器 拿不到,页面也看不到。div.appendTo("body"); ??//追加到body最后面。console.log($("div"));//页面出现,jQuery选择器选到。

创建/增加属性  

var link1=$(‘<a>‘,{ ?????text: ‘baidu‘, ?????href: ‘http://www.baidu.com‘, ?????target: ‘_blank‘, ?????title: ‘goto baidu‘ });link1.appendTo(‘body‘);//第一种方法适合空元素。var link2=$(‘<a>baidu</a>‘).attr({ ?????href: ‘http://www.baidu.com‘, ?????target: ‘_blank‘, ?????title: ‘goto baidu‘});link2.appendTo(‘body‘);
//第二种使用attr();

 jQuery操作

$().length; //检查元素[index] ??//提取元素,返回domget([]) ??//提取元素,返回domget() ??//不加索引,返回数组对象。get(-1) ??//从最后元素取。 ?-2,-3依次倒退。//越界出现undefined.eq(index) ??//返回jQuery对象。 ??

first() ?//第一个
last() ??//最后一个

方法的性能大于筛选器;

toArray() ??和不加参数的get一样返回集合。

  

 

 

慕课 jQuery ?2018/6/21

原文地址:https://www.cnblogs.com/xxh-2014/p/9208331.html

知识推荐

我的编程学习网——分享web前端后端开发技术知识。 垃圾信息处理邮箱 tousu563@163.com 网站地图
icp备案号 闽ICP备2023006418号-8 不良信息举报平台 互联网安全管理备案 Copyright 2023 www.wodecom.cn All Rights Reserved